How To Clean Portable Facial Steamer. Keeping them clean shows your commitment to hygiene and customer safety! This simple process effectively removes mineral deposits and bacteria buildup, ensuring a clean and hygienic steaming experience. Facial steamers get a lot of use in any busy salon or spa. Brought to you by cci beauty this video teaches you some simple steps to maintain and clean your facial steamer. To clean a facial steamer with vinegar, mix equal parts vinegar and water, and then run the solution through the steamer according to manufacturer instructions. Add the solution to the water reservoir, turn. Use distilled water, white vinegar, and a lemon to clean your steamer and keep bacterial growth and mineral deposits at bay. Learn daily and monthly tips on how to clean your. Disconnect and empty the steamer. Prepare a cleaning solution by mixing one part white vinegar with three parts distilled water.
